22:

Formular:


atomic \: mass = ( \sum(isotopic \: mass * \%abundance))/(100) \\

substitute:


atomic \: mass = ((23.985 * 78.70) + (24.986 * 10.13) + (25.983 * 11.17))/(100) \\ \\ = ((1887.620) + (253.108) + (290.230))/(100) \\ \\ = (2430.958)/(100) \\ \\ { \boxed{ \boxed{average \: atomic \: mass = 24.3 \: amu}}}
